Power-Ups and Strategic Application
Many iterations of the game introduce power-ups that can momentarily alter the gameplay. These might include a brief period of invincibility, allowing the chicken to pass through vehicles unharmed; a temporary slowdown of traffic, providing more reaction time; or a speed boost, allowing the chicken to quickly dash across the road. However, these power-ups are often limited in duration or availability, requiring players to use them judiciously. Mastering the strategic application of power-ups is crucial for achieving high scores and conquering the more challenging levels. Knowing when to activate a boost, rather than simply having a boost available, often makes the difference between success and failure.
Furthermore, some versions incorporate collectible items that contribute to the overall score or unlock hidden content. This added layer of motivation encourages players to take calculated risks, venturing into more dangerous areas of the road in pursuit of higher rewards. The interplay between risk, reward, and strategic power-up usage adds a remarkable amount of depth to a game that appears remarkably simple on the surface.
| Power-Up | Effect |
|---|---|
| Invincibility | Allows the chicken to pass through vehicles without being harmed for a limited time. |
| Slow Motion | Temporarily reduces the speed of traffic, providing more time to react. |
| Speed Boost | Increases the chicken's speed, allowing for quicker movement across the road. |
| Shield | Offers a single-use buffer against an oncoming vehicle. |
Understanding the nuances of each power-up and how they interact with the game’s dynamics is a key element of mastering the gameplay. Players often develop specific strategies, tailoring their power-up usage to different levels and traffic patterns.
The Psychology of Addictive Gameplay
The success of this type of game isn't merely due to its simple mechanics; it taps into fundamental psychological principles that drive addictive behavior. The intermittent reinforcement schedule – where rewards are delivered unpredictably – is a major contributor. Players aren't consistently rewarded for their efforts, but the occasional success is enough to keep them engaged and motivated to continue playing. This is similar to the principles behind slot machines, which rely on near misses and occasional jackpots to maintain player interest. The game also leverages the "flow state," a psychological concept describing a state of deep immersion and enjoyment, characterized by a balance between challenge and skill.
When the challenge presented by the game aligns with a player's skill level, they are more likely to enter this flow state, losing track of time and becoming completely absorbed in the gameplay experience. As skills improve, the game progressively increases the difficulty, preventing boredom and maintaining a consistent level of engagement. The sense of agency – the feeling of control over one's actions and their consequences – is also important. Players feel responsible for the chicken's fate, and the successful navigation of the road provides a sense of accomplishment and satisfaction. The inherent challenge and the potential for failure create a sense of tension and excitement, further contributing to the game's addictive nature.
